Cuban Father and Son Return to Iceland

The Cuban father and son who were driven away from Iceland due to racial persecution are returning to Iceland tomorrow after spending two weeks abroad. However, according to the father’s Icelandic partner, they are afraid to move back into their apartment.

“We are extremely grateful for the support that the nation, our neighbors and everyone has shown us,” the father’s partner, who prefers to remain anonymous, told visir.is.

“The event has marked us. We have yet to return to our apartment and I doubt we will ever be able to,” she said, adding that the whole family is in shock. The windows of the house where they lived were smashed.

Jón Hilmar Hallgrímsson was taken to custody for alleged racial persecution but has since been released. He maintains his innocence and claims this case is not related to racism.

Hallgrímsson was recently interviewed on Sölvi Tryggvason’s chat program on Skjár 1. The Cuban father’s partner said she had watched the interview. “This is his version. The police will investigate this case,” she commented.

According to RÚV, Hallgrímsson is a notorious drug debt collector. Hallgrímsson, who goes by Jón stóri (“Big Jón”), stated he has collected debts but not violently.

It is believed that the source of the persecution might have been a conversation between the Cuban son’s Icelandic girlfriend and an Icelandic boy.
